Understanding High Pressure vs Low Pressure Washing Techniques

High stress washing makes use of a helpful jet of water to put off filth, dust, mold, mould, and other unwanted materials from surfaces. The strain can reach up to four,000 psi (kilos in step with rectangular inch), making it nice for powerful jobs like cleansing driveways, sidewalks, and decks.

Low tension washing, alternatively, characteristically operates at a far diminish psi—always between 500-1,500 psi. This technique is gentler and is often used for greater mild surfaces similar to roofs and siding. It often employs a combination of water and specialized detergents that help in lifting stains with out damaging the surface under.

Both techniques have their rightful location in assets preservation yet knowing while to take advantage of each one can prevent time and cash even as preserving your property’s integrity.

What Is the Best Method of Roof Cleaning?

When on the grounds that "What is the leading approach of roof cleaning?" that's mandatory to aspect in the roofing cloth:

For asphalt shingles: A low-strain wash with compatible chemicals ensures toughness. Tile roofs: Gentle washing enables hinder chipping or breaking. Metal roofs: Both programs can work; despite the fact that, low pressure tends to be more secure.

Engaging execs with feel will guarantee you decide on the finest procedure adapted particularly for your sort of roof even as minimizing any disadvantages concerned.

How Often Should You Do Roof Cleaning?

Most gurus propose acting roof cleansing every 2–three years based on local weather situations:

In humid climates prone to moss or algae development - suppose annual cleanings. Dry spaces may just best desire realization as soon as each and every few years.
